the muratic bath will do more then any of the above, make sure there is no bleach or bleach residue when you go to do the muratic bath, make sure to wear goggles and a mask when pouring it into the water and not to splash yourself, bath usually only last 3-4 hours and then empty and personally i let a hose run for several hours in the tub to keep flushing it out, then let soak for few days in ro water, then empty and soak for a couple more days, maybe more then needed but wanted to be sure

After a 6 hour overhaul that involved all pumps disassembled and soaked in a vinegar bath.all hoses where replaced with new ones...also relocated the return hole(never understood why they made the solana return on the middle of the back wall rather than up top where it belongs)i put 75% of the 10 year old established live rock back in the tank as I'm sure there will be a small cycle that ill be ready for with water changes.as for the hang on refugium everything is connected just didn't operate it yet.im waiting till everything is ok with the water paremters and I'm a little concerned with 2.5 gallons being added to the main tank if there is ever a power outage(need to find an inline back pressure fitting)
Eventually ill be upgrading to a 60 cube where ill have more grow out room for corals
